Manufacturing near Newchapel, England

Companies

Manufacturing - Newchapel England

  • Ovenden Signs
    Unit 2, The Laurels, Blackberry Ln, Lingfield, Surrey RH7 6NG, United Kingdom
  • Trade In Places
    West Prk road, 10 The Lodge, Newchapel, Surrey RH7 6LZ, United Kingdom